Sleeve date Dec 15. Started my preop diet 5 days ago. I can eat a piece of shoe leather right now, I am so hungry. Help!
Surgery won't be canceled, everything will be ok. Not all doctors require a 2 week pre-op diet. According to my Dr, there was a study done recently which showrd that the size and amount of fat on the liver didn't change significantly enough during the pre-op diet to actually make a difference. My Dr. only told me to eat light the week before surgery and drink only liquids for up to 3 days before surgery so that there is no foodin your stomach when they operate. He also mentioned that Dr's do the two week liquid diet so that the patients get used to the liquid diet for 2 weeks after surgery.

Psychiatric Evaluation
Just had my psych eval, and I feel as if it was too quick, and too easy. I was out in under 10 minutes. The Dr. did say when I walked in that it would be quick, unless he felt I had some issues I had to work out first, but I didn't think it was going to be that fast either. I'm sitting here, now, wondering if maybe I answered something the wrong way and that's why he dismissed me so quickly. =/
